#pragma once
#include "InspectorAgentBase.h"
#include "InspectorBackendDispatchers.h"
#include <wtf/Forward.h>
#include <wtf/Noncopyable.h>
namespace JSC {
class Debugger;
class VM;
}
namespace Inspector {
class InjectedScript;
class InjectedScriptManager;
class JS_EXPORT_PRIVATE InspectorRuntimeAgent : public InspectorAgentBase, public RuntimeBackendDispatcherHandler {
WTF_MAKE_NONCOPYABLE(InspectorRuntimeAgent);
WTF_MAKE_FAST_ALLOCATED;
public:
~InspectorRuntimeAgent() override;
// InspectorAgentBase
void didCreateFrontendAndBackend(Inspector::FrontendRouter*, Inspector::BackendDispatcher*) final;
void willDestroyFrontendAndBackend(DisconnectReason) final;
// RuntimeBackendDispatcherHandler
Protocol::ErrorStringOr<void> enable() override;
Protocol::ErrorStringOr<void> disable() override;
Protocol::ErrorStringOr<std::tuple<Protocol::Runtime::SyntaxErrorType, String /* message */, RefPtr<Protocol::Runtime::ErrorRange>>> parse(const String& expression) final;
Protocol::ErrorStringOr<std::tuple<Ref<Protocol::Runtime::RemoteObject>, std::optional<bool> /* wasThrown */, std::optional<int> /* savedResultIndex */>> evaluate(const String& expression, const String& objectGroup, std::optional<bool>&& includeCommandLineAPI, std::optional<bool>&& doNotPauseOnExceptionsAndMuteConsole, std::optional<Protocol::Runtime::ExecutionContextId>&&, std::optional<bool>&& returnByValue, std::optional<bool>&& generatePreview, std::optional<bool>&& saveResult, std::optional<bool>&& emulateUserGesture) override;
void awaitPromise(const Protocol::Runtime::RemoteObjectId&, std::optional<bool>&& returnByValue, std::optional<bool>&& generatePreview, std::optional<bool>&& saveResult, Ref<AwaitPromiseCallback>&&) final;
Protocol::ErrorStringOr<std::tuple<Ref<Protocol::Runtime::RemoteObject>, std::optional<bool> /* wasThrown */>> callFunctionOn(const Protocol::Runtime::RemoteObjectId&, const String& functionDeclaration, RefPtr<JSON::Array>&& arguments, std::optional<bool>&& doNotPauseOnExceptionsAndMuteConsole, std::optional<bool>&& returnByValue, std::optional<bool>&& generatePreview, std::optional<bool>&& emulateUserGesture) override;
Protocol::ErrorStringOr<void> releaseObject(const Protocol::Runtime::RemoteObjectId&) final;
Protocol::ErrorStringOr<Ref<Protocol::Runtime::ObjectPreview>> getPreview(const Protocol::Runtime::RemoteObjectId&) final;
Protocol::ErrorStringOr<std::tuple<Ref<JSON::ArrayOf<Protocol::Runtime::PropertyDescriptor>>, RefPtr<JSON::ArrayOf<Protocol::Runtime::InternalPropertyDescriptor>>>> getProperties(const Protocol::Runtime::RemoteObjectId&, std::optional<bool>&& ownProperties, std::optional<int>&& fetchStart, std::optional<int>&& fetchCount, std::optional<bool>&& generatePreview) final;
Protocol::ErrorStringOr<std::tuple<Ref<JSON::ArrayOf<Protocol::Runtime::PropertyDescriptor>>, RefPtr<JSON::ArrayOf<Protocol::Runtime::InternalPropertyDescriptor>>>> getDisplayableProperties(const Protocol::Runtime::RemoteObjectId&, std::optional<int>&& fetchStart, std::optional<int>&& fetchCount, std::optional<bool>&& generatePreview) final;
Protocol::ErrorStringOr<Ref<JSON::ArrayOf<Protocol::Runtime::CollectionEntry>>> getCollectionEntries(const Protocol::Runtime::RemoteObjectId&, const String& objectGroup, std::optional<int>&& fetchStart, std::optional<int>&& fetchCount) final;
Protocol::ErrorStringOr<std::optional<int> /* saveResultIndex */> saveResult(Ref<JSON::Object>&& callArgument, std::optional<Protocol::Runtime::ExecutionContextId>&&) final;
Protocol::ErrorStringOr<void> setSavedResultAlias(const String&) final;
Protocol::ErrorStringOr<void> releaseObjectGroup(const String&) final;
Protocol::ErrorStringOr<Ref<JSON::ArrayOf<Protocol::Runtime::TypeDescription>>> getRuntimeTypesForVariablesAtOffsets(Ref<JSON::Array>&& locations) final;
Protocol::ErrorStringOr<void> enableTypeProfiler() final;
Protocol::ErrorStringOr<void> disableTypeProfiler() final;
Protocol::ErrorStringOr<void> enableControlFlowProfiler() final;
Protocol::ErrorStringOr<void> disableControlFlowProfiler() final;
Protocol::ErrorStringOr<Ref<JSON::ArrayOf<Protocol::Runtime::BasicBlock>>> getBasicBlocks(const String& sourceID) final;
protected:
InspectorRuntimeAgent(AgentContext&);
InjectedScriptManager& injectedScriptManager() { return m_injectedScriptManager; }
virtual InjectedScript injectedScriptForEval(Protocol::ErrorString&, std::optional<Protocol::Runtime::ExecutionContextId>&&) = 0;
virtual void muteConsole() = 0;
virtual void unmuteConsole() = 0;
private:
void setTypeProfilerEnabledState(bool);
void setControlFlowProfilerEnabledState(bool);
InjectedScriptManager& m_injectedScriptManager;
JSC::Debugger& m_debugger;
JSC::VM& m_vm;
bool m_enabled {false};
bool m_isTypeProfilingEnabled {false};
bool m_isControlFlowProfilingEnabled {false};
};
} // namespace Inspector
